Uses of Class
com.yahoo.processing.Response
-
Packages that use Response Package Description com.yahoo.processing Java library for request-response data processing.com.yahoo.processing.execution com.yahoo.processing.handler com.yahoo.processing.processors com.yahoo.processing.rendering com.yahoo.processing.response com.yahoo.processing.test -
-
Uses of Response in com.yahoo.processing
Methods in com.yahoo.processing that return Response Modifier and Type Method Description abstract Response
Processor. process(Request request, Execution execution)
Performs a processing request and returns the responseMethods in com.yahoo.processing with parameters of type Response Modifier and Type Method Description void
Response. mergeWith(Response other)
Processors which merges another request into this must call this method to notify the response. -
Uses of Response in com.yahoo.processing.execution
Methods in com.yahoo.processing.execution that return Response Modifier and Type Method Description protected Response
Execution. defaultResponse(Request request)
Creates the default response to return from this kind of execution when there are no further processors.protected Response
ExecutionWithResponse. defaultResponse(Request request)
Response
RunnableExecution. getResponse()
Returns the response from executing this, or null if exception is set or run() has not been called yetResponse
Execution. process(Request request)
Calls process on the next processor in this chain.Methods in com.yahoo.processing.execution that return types with arguments of type Response Modifier and Type Method Description static List<Response>
AsyncExecution. waitForAll(Collection<FutureResponse> tasks, long timeout)
Methods in com.yahoo.processing.execution with parameters of type Response Modifier and Type Method Description protected void
Execution. onReturning(Request request, Processor processor, Response response)
A hook called when a processor returns, either normally or by throwing.void
ResponseReceiver. setResponse(Response response)
Constructors in com.yahoo.processing.execution with parameters of type Response Constructor Description ExecutionWithResponse(Chain<? extends Processor> chain, Response response, Execution execution)
Creates an execution which will return a given response at the end of the chain. -
Uses of Response in com.yahoo.processing.handler
Methods in com.yahoo.processing.handler that return types with arguments of type Response Modifier and Type Method Description Renderer<Response>
AbstractProcessingHandler. getRendererCopy(com.yahoo.component.ComponentSpecification spec)
For internal use onlyConstructors in com.yahoo.processing.handler with parameters of type Response Constructor Description ProcessingResponse(int status, Request processingRequest, Response processingResponse, Renderer renderer, Executor renderingExecutor, Execution execution)
-
Uses of Response in com.yahoo.processing.processors
Methods in com.yahoo.processing.processors that return Response Modifier and Type Method Description Response
RequestPropertyTracer. process(Request request, Execution execution)
-
Uses of Response in com.yahoo.processing.rendering
Classes in com.yahoo.processing.rendering with type parameters of type Response Modifier and Type Class Description class
AsynchronousRenderer<RESPONSE extends Response>
Superclass of all asynchronous renderers.class
AsynchronousSectionedRenderer<RESPONSE extends Response>
Helper class to implement processing API Response renderers.class
Renderer<RESPONSE extends Response>
Renders a response to a stream.Methods in com.yahoo.processing.rendering that return Response Modifier and Type Method Description Response
AsynchronousSectionedRenderer. getResponse()
The response render callbacks are generated from. -
Uses of Response in com.yahoo.processing.response
Methods in com.yahoo.processing.response that return Response Modifier and Type Method Description Response
FutureResponse. get()
Response
FutureResponse. get(long timeout, TimeUnit timeunit)
Methods in com.yahoo.processing.response that return types with arguments of type Response Modifier and Type Method Description FutureTask<Response>
FutureResponse. delegate()
Constructor parameters in com.yahoo.processing.response with type arguments of type Response Constructor Description FutureResponse(Callable<Response> callable, Execution execution, Request request)
-
Uses of Response in com.yahoo.processing.test
Methods in com.yahoo.processing.test that return Response Modifier and Type Method Description Response
ProcessorLibrary.AsyncDataProcessingInitiator. process(Request request, Execution execution)
Response
ProcessorLibrary.BlockingSplitter. process(Request request, Execution execution)
Response
ProcessorLibrary.CombineData. process(Request request, Execution execution)
Response
ProcessorLibrary.DataCounter. process(Request request, Execution execution)
Response
ProcessorLibrary.DataSource. process(Request request, Execution execution)
Response
ProcessorLibrary.EagerReturnFederator. process(Request request, Execution execution)
Response
ProcessorLibrary.Echo. process(Request request, Execution execution)
Response
ProcessorLibrary.ErrorAdder. process(Request request, Execution execution)
Response
ProcessorLibrary.Federator. process(Request request, Execution execution)
Response
ProcessorLibrary.FutureDataSource. process(Request request, Execution execution)
Response
ProcessorLibrary.Get6DataItems. process(Request request, Execution execution)
Response
ProcessorLibrary.ListenableFutureDataSource. process(Request request, Execution execution)
Response
ProcessorLibrary.LogValueAdder. process(Request request, Execution execution)
Response
ProcessorLibrary.RequestCounter. process(Request request, Execution execution)
Response
ProcessorLibrary.StatusSetter. process(Request request, Execution execution)
Response
ProcessorLibrary.StreamProcessingInitiator. process(Request request, Execution execution)
Response
ProcessorLibrary.StringDataAdder. process(Request request, Execution execution)
Response
ProcessorLibrary.StringDataListAdder. process(Request request, Execution execution)
Response
ProcessorLibrary.Trace. process(Request request, Execution execution)
-